2026-06-07 21:57:30
嘿,朋友!今天咱们来聊聊区块链。你有没有听说过这个词?或许你会想:“这东西到底是什么?”让我们揭开神秘的面纱。简单来说,区块链是一种分布式账本技术。这意味着它不是存储在某个中心服务器上,而是遍布在世界各地的许多计算机上。信息一旦写入就很难被篡改,这就是它的魅力所在。
说到区块链,就不得不提到密码学。你知道吗,密码学就像是区块链的护身符,保证了我们数据的安全性和隐私。在区块链中,密码学主要有以下几种特点:
哈希函数是区块链中最常用的密码学工具。简单点说,哈希函数可以将输入的数据“压缩”成一个固定长度的字符串。这一操作具有唯一性,输入不同内容,哈希结果就不一样。例如,你把“你好”用哈希函数算出来得到一个字符串,试想,如果你把“你好,朋友”再算一遍,得到的结果就完全不一样。
而且,哈希函数是单向的,你不能通过结果去反推原始数据。这一点在区块链中特别重要,因为它保护了用户的隐私信息。
说到安全,公钥和私钥就像是一把锁和一把钥匙。公钥可以分享给别人,像你的邮箱地址;但私钥就必须严格保管,就像你的银行卡密码。只有拥有私钥的人,才能解锁与之对应的数字资产。
如果你把数字货币发送给别人,实际上你只需用他们的公钥进行交易。而收款的人则需要用自己的私钥确认这笔交易。你能想象,这就像是在保护你私密的铂金宝藏吗?
数字签名是另一个非常关键的概念。它保证了消息的真实性和完整性。想象一下,你给朋友写了一封信,签上自己的名字。朋友一看,就知道是你写的。数字签名的原理差不多,就是通过公钥和私钥的结合,确保信息没有被篡改。
在区块链中,所有的交易都需要数字签名,确保这个交易是由合法的账户发起的。这么一来,谁都不能随便修改别人的交易记录。
我们常说区块链具有抗攻击的能力。这是因为数据分布在网络中的每一个节点上。想象一下,攻击者想要篡改某个数据记录,那么他们必须改变网络中超过一半的节点数据。显然,这几乎是不可能的。这就提高了区块链的耐抵抗性,保护了系统免受恶意破坏。
最后,区块链的一个重要特点就是去中心化。以前我们在银行借贷,所有的交易都要经过中央银行,但区块链没有这个问题。它是由许多用户共同维护的,每个人都有参与的权利。如此一来,整个网络就不会因为某一个节点的崩溃而受到影响。
想象一下,一个没有单一控制者的网络,多么令人振奋!这就像是一个大家庭,大家都在为集体利益而努力。
说起区块链,我曾经参加过一次关于数字货币的讲座。会上,有个小伙子讲了自己的经历:他投资了某种数字货币,一开始亏了不少钱,但他并没有放弃,而是一直学习区块链的知识,最后又成功地翻身了。听完他的故事,我深刻感受到,学习和实践才是打开这个新世界的钥匙。
如今,区块链密码学的应用场景越来越广泛,从金融到医疗,再到供应链,几乎无处不在。我觉得这将是未来的发展方向。而我们作为普通人,了解这些知识,才能更好地适应未来的变化。
所以,啥是区块链密码特点?哈希函数、数字签名、公钥私钥、耐抵抗性以及去中心化。这一些特色构成了区块链的安全防护网。未来的数字世界,等着我们去探索。希望这篇分享能帮助你更好地理解这个复杂却又充满机会的领域。下次再聊,我们一起继续深挖区块链的奥秘吧!